Handover note — Brindle SDK parity (from Osric to Tamsin)

Support team: the Kotlin and Swift clients for Marrowgate are now at parity except for offline queue compaction, which lands in Swift next sprint. Until then, expect tickets about larger cache files on iPad devices; this is known and harmless. Both SDKs read the same remote profile, so reproduce issues with identical settings. The shared client configuration currently served is as follows.

deployment values, faduf-tawep:
SORDOR_LOG_LEVEL=error
SORDOR_METRICS_HOST=metrics.sordor.nelvrolabs.internal
SORDOR_POOL_SIZE=4

Runbook: Stale session-token refresh in Marrowlark

If a customer says they're getting logged out every few minutes, it's almost certainly this one. The refresh job in Marrowlark 4.2 compares token expiry in UTC but issues tokens in the gateway's local zone, so anything west of the Verdine region expires early. Quick fix: have them sign out fully and back in once, which forces a UTC-issued token. The patched build is already rolling out; its token appears right below for reference.

pipeline stamp: htk31_f769b577b3028a4e9958e5bb8d1259a

Subject: DR drill tomorrow — Bucketeer assignment service

Hey, quick heads-up: tomorrow's disaster-recovery drill takes down the primary Bucketeer cluster at 09:00. You'll need to restore the assignment snapshot in the Fallow Creek standby region. Everything's scripted except the vault unlock step, which is manual on purpose. Use the passphrase below when prompted.

vault phrase of tajeg-tageg = pelix-druix-holius-briael-zorwyn-frawyn-fraox-norok-drueth-aldiel